Services

North East LHIN plans, funds and coordinates the following operational public health care services to a population of approximately 550,000 people: * 34 Hospitals - see below * 42 Long-Term Care Homes * 1 Community Care Access Centre (CCAC) * 64 Community Support Service Agencies * 48 Mental Health and Addiction Agencies * 6 Community Health Centres (CHCs)
